- In addition to managing water, outdoor drainage mats also help to prevent erosion. Erosion occurs when water removes soil particles from the surface, leading to loss of soil and a destabilized environment. By providing a barrier between the surface and the water, drainage mats help to protect the soil and prevent erosion. Maintaining French drain mats is relatively straightforward, yet it is vital for their continued effectiveness. Regular inspections should be conducted to check for signs of erosion or sediment buildup. If any issues are detected, they should be addressed promptly to prevent undermining the system's functionality. Proper landscaping practices, such as grading the soil, can also help direct water away from the drainage area, preserving the mat’s integrity.

One of the primary applications of weather stripping felt is around doors and windows, where air leaks most commonly occur. Gaps between frames and sashes can lead to significant energy loss, especially during extreme weather conditions. By applying weather stripping felt, homeowners can reduce drafts, keep out dust and insects, and enhance the overall comfort of their interiors.

- 5. Down Down is a soft, fluffy material that provides excellent insulation and warmth. It is often used in duvets and pillows and is known for its ability to mold to the shape of your body. Down bedding is available in various fill powers, which determine its loft and warmth level. However, down can be expensive and may not be suitable for people with allergies or asthma.

- Hospital bed sheets, typically made from high-quality cotton or a blend of cotton and synthetic materials, are designed to withstand frequent washing and sterilization, essential in a medical setting where infection control is paramount. The choice of material is critical as it needs to be soft against the skin, yet durable enough to endure the rigors of hospital use. Sheets are usually white, a color that not only symbolizes cleanliness but also allows for easy detection of any stains or spills.

Bamboo viscose is popular because it is soft, smooth, silky, temperature-regulating, and moisture-wicking. It is also often popularly cited as an environmentally-friendly material. This is becausebamboo is a relatively sustainable plantto grow, because it grows quickly, doesn’t require much irrigation or intense cultivation, and doesn’t require chemical pesticides or fertilizers. Bamboo also absorbs more carbon and produces more oxygen than other similar plants.

Cotton is a staple fabric spun from the fibers of cotton plants. People around the world have been cultivating it for thousands of years. One of the earliest bits of cotton is at least 7,000 years old and was found in Mexico. In Egypt and Pakistan, people were weaving cotton thread into clothing in 3,000 BC. And in the 18th century, the British first found a way to spin cotton into textile with machinery.
